Parquet Flooring Explained:
The Old French word parquet translates to “little enclosed area.” Herringbone is the most common pattern created by the floor, which is made out of geometric, almost mosaic-style pieces of wood.
Although solid wood flooring used to be the only material used to create parquet flooring in the past, engineered flooring is currently becoming more and more popular.
Engineered parquet flooring is ideal for basements and bathrooms because it produces a firm core that is impervious to fluctuations in temperature and moisture.

What are the benefits of luxury vinyl tile flooring?
The word luxury vinyl tile is frequently used when discussing new flooring, and for good reason. The adaptable flooring choice known as luxury vinyl tile flooring often referred to as vinyl plank flooring, is available in thin planks rather than the typical square-shaped tile that most homeowners are used to.
Luxury vinyl flooring is a cost-effective flooring option that can replicate the appearance of wood at a fraction of the price because of its rectangular plank design. But that’s only the beginning of the numerous advantages of luxury vinyl tile.

Cost:
Do you like hardwood floors but your estimate is confusing you? Look no further than luxury vinyl tile, a far more affordable solution that enables you to have the same elegance for a fraction of the price.
For homeowners on a tight budget or those who need to cover vast square footage, hardwood is a better alternative because it typically costs five to ten times more than vinyl flooring.
In addition to being more reasonably priced, luxury vinyl planks are also rather simple for the typical homeowner to install themselves, saving money over paying a flooring company to perform the job. In comparison to other flooring options like tile, where you must additionally buy additional supplies like grout, you’ll also save money.
